About this listen

The essential companion workbook to the bestseller The 8th Habit.

From Stephen R. Covey, bestselling author of The 8th Habit: From Effectiveness to Greatness, comes the accompanying personal workbook that will help you further realize the power of this new habit. The world has changed dramatically since Covey's classic The 7 Habits of Highly Effective People was published. The challenges we all face in our relationships, families, professional lives and communities are of an entirely new order of magnitude. In order to thrive in what Covey calls the new Knowledge Worker Age, we need to build on and move beyond effectiveness—to greatness. Accessing the higher reaches of human genius and motivation in today's reality requires a whole new habit.

The questionnaires, tests, self-assessments, and other exercises in this workbook provide a hands-on approach to developing the mind-set, skill-set and tool-set for achieving greatness in the Knowledge Worker Age. The 8th Habit will transform the way you think about yourself and your purpose in life, about your organization and about humankind.

I loved the 7 Habits and the fact that so millions have had their lives changed by it is testament to its significance. This comes across as a reflection on the potential impact of those habits, but it seems a lot less structured and lacks the clarity of his previous works. He doesn’t clearly define the 8th Habit but it basically appears to be very similarly to the 6th Habit (Synergy) with most of the other habits (be proactive etc) thrown into the mix. The fact that I left without a clear idea or definition of the 8th Habit strikes me as the main weakness of this book - maybe therefore there are only 7 Habits after all?
